W.H. Freeman to Bundle JMP® Student Edition with Introductory Statistics TextbooksVisual, interactive software gives college students the edge on mastering statisticsCARY, NC (Jul. 11, 2007) – SAS, the leader in business intelligence and advanced analytics, today announced an agreement with W.H. Freeman to bundle JMP Student Edition, a streamlined version of its JMP statistical discovery software, with leading statistics textbooks sold through college bookstores. By selecting textbooks that bundle JMP Student Edition, professors enable students to install a personal copy of the software that will help them learn statistics. JMP Student Edition contains all the statistics covered in first-year and intermediate college statistics courses. “It’s a visual and interactive application that offers an intuitive interface that mirrors the applied real-world approach of modern courses,” says Curt Hinrichs, JMP Academic Program Manager. “JMP Student Edition offers all the capabilities an elementary or intermediate student needs, without the higher price or advanced features of our full corporate and academic versions of JMP.” “Software and online resources are popular learning tools demanded by professors, authors and students alike. JMP Student Edition offers the opportunity to complement some of our most popular statistics titles with learning by doing,” says Craig Bleyer, W.H. Freeman Senior Publisher for Economics, Math, Statistics and the Physical Sciences. Some of the initial titles with which JMP Student Edition will be bundled include The Basic Practice of Statistics by David Moore; Introduction to the Practice of Statistics by David Moore and George McCabe; and The Practice of Business Statistics by David Moore, George McCabe, William Duckworth and Stanley Sclove. The full version of JMP is licensed by companies worldwide and is also available on many university departmental and campus servers.
